  2. The Gus Macker 3-on-3 Basketball Tournament is a nationwide event for players of a variety of age and skill levels in the United States. Although every tournament is different, a typical Gus Macker event involves basketball courts set up in parking lots or closed-off public streets.

  3. Gus Macker Basketball is more than just a game; it's a celebration of basketball, community, and the spirit of competition. Founded in 1974 by Scott McNeal, the Macker tournament began as a small, backyard gathering of friends in Lowell, Michigan.
